Petros Demarinis Obituary

Petros Demarinis passed away on Monday Jan. 5, 2015. He was preceded in death by his mother Kalliope Zouloufou Karagiannis and sister Xaroula. He is survived by his wife Eleftheria Zoe Mantikos Demarinis, daughters Kalliope (Kelly) Mullins and Paraskevi (Vivian) Haik, sisters Niki and Despina, brothers Sakelaris, Nikos, George Karagiannis and two grandchildren Michael and Eli Mullins, son in law Mark Mullins and Jeffrey O'Hara. He was born in Rhodes Greece and moved to New Orleans in 1970. Over the past 45 years he has been a Chanter in the Greek Orthodox Holy Trinity Church. He served as chairman of the Greek Festival for 15 years and was instrumental in helping the festival grow into one of the most beloved festivals in New Orleans. He spent years working at the Royal Sonesta Hotel and East Jefferson General Hospital. He taught formal Greek School classes out of his home for 30 years to anyone interested in learning about Greek culture, history and how to read and write Greek. He was deeply passionate about Greek culture and the Orthodox church. He was a motivated educator and balanced it all perfectly with the art of enjoying life itself. In 2013 Petros was awarded The Archangel Gabriel Award by His Eminence Metropolitan Alexios in Atlanta GA recognizing his service in the Greek community as a "living example of the Orthodox Christian life and journey to Theosis."
